Got the engine mounts done

Image

Image

I was a little worried about the lack of room between the steering box and the pwr steer pulley, but a shorter pwr steer belt helped that

Image

A few pics of the new radiator cross member and fan mount/shroud

Image

Image

Image

Also a shot of the clutch slave cyl, which is a 2L diesel one and the hardline is the 3Y one I think

Image

The remote pwr steer reservoir mounted on the inner guard and plumbed in using various 2L,3Y and 7M lines. Had to get a new high pressure side line from pump to steering box made up :(

Image

Left to do,
Fuel lines and pump
Air box
Relocate Battery
Clutch line from master cyl to slave
Top radiator hose
Electrical

Ok, Ive worked out how much this exercise has cost me and a list of parts I used so others who want to do this will know what they are in for. Bear in mind I didn't try to do this on a tight budget, so you could save a bit on some cheaper/second hand parts.

Engine (1990 7mge) $600
New pwr steer hose $150
Pwr Steer belt $18
Alternator belt $20
Radiator Recore $220
Electric Fan $80
Davies Craig Fan controller $90
Top Rad Hose (Maxima) $32
Battery (NS70L) $90
Simota Pod Filter $97
Spark Plugs $36
Oil & Pwr Steer Fluid $60
Fuel Hoses and Fittings $120
Clutch line $12
Certification $400 :evil:
Exhaust $380
Supra Clutch $80
Parts Total--- $2511

This does not include doing the head gasket "just incase",or my autosparkies time, or my own labor

Here's a list of secondhand bits I used

2L diesel Fuel hard lines
2L diesel engine mounts
5M upper engine mounts
5M Supra Flywheel,Bell housing
2L diesel clutch slave cyl
2L diesel radiator
Bosch Fuel Pump (044)

But the end result is a Surf that goes great and is far more enjoyable to drive. I highly recommend this swap if your 3y or 2L has shit itself.
The whole conversion was surprisingly easy, and once done looks like it was in there from factory.

Hi Mike,
Mike Holland (Suprasurf) hooked me up with it, one of his mates in ChCH was going to do the same swap but did a 1UZFE instead I think. I reakon a Turbo 7m would be easier to find (out of a Turbo Supra, and probably easier to get a manual setup for it too). Or mebbe buy a whole Cressida with a 7mge is an option too, you get ALL the wiring, fuel pump,sensors,plugs,ecu blah blah.
Your Surf is IFS?, you need a 50mm lift I think, not sure on that tho.
Its a greeat conversion tho, and flew through cert, no worries. Mechanically the swap is easy, paerticularly if you have the "rare as hens teeth" 5M belhousing, electrically its a bit of a mission if like me you know nothing about wires, but my brother said if he did another one it would be untold quicker. At the end of the day there is only about six wires you have to hook up and it goes.
